Just when we were asking 'should we stay or should we go?', a beautifully and outrageously fun romp lands in our laps as we watch the Power Rangers Turbo episode 'Clash of the Megazords'!

Why do we spend a good deal of time talking about a Billy Zane action movie? What legitimately funny monster gag absolutely delighted us? And what does Michael declare perhaps the best Power Rangers action scene of all time? Find out, in this uncharacteristically upbeat episode of the Ranger Danger Turbo podcast!